Introduction to Computer Networks(网络架构与七( 三 )


如果我们要传送的封包很重要,就要自己想办法保证送到 。而TCP是可以做到的(),这个后面再讲 。
3. Cost-(网络上的资源如何做有效的共享?)
1) : links and nodes

Introduction to Computer Networks(网络架构与七

文章插图
图4flows over alink
图4中,交换机之间的绿色的link就属于需要共享的,而和也属于nodes,也属于 。
2) How to share a link ?
a)
多路复用(,又称“多工”)是一个通信和计算机网络领域的专业术语,在没有歧义的情况下,“多路复用”也可被称为“复用” 。多路复用通常表示在一个信道上传输多路信号或数据流的过程和技术 。(摘自wiki)
FDM:(频分复用)
【Introduction to Computer Networks(网络架构与七】
Introduction to Computer Networks(网络架构与七

文章插图
例如此图,将频宽分成4份,也就是有4个频道,每个频道的频宽只有原来的1/4,但是这4个用户可以同时传送封包,只是速度慢些而已 。每个用户都有专用的频道 。我们将分割()了,因此称为频分 。
Time-(TDM 时分复用)
Introduction to Computer Networks(网络架构与七

文章插图
将时间进行,不同的user在不同的时段传送封包(此处,每个时段user用的都是整个link的频宽) 。
注意:无论FDM还是TDM都是的技术,但是其最大的问题就是:万一负载不平衡,比如有些用户想送的资料很多,而有些用户想送的很少,甚至没有,即使这样,频道或者时段也是不可以借用的(开始分配好,就固定下来了),因此效率还是比较差的 。
那有没有技术,使得传的少的能借资源给传的多的呢?请看。
b) De- 的逆过程
c)(统计多工)
Introduction to Computer Networks(网络架构与七

文章插图
还是这张图,多个共用中间那条用绿色粗线标记的Link 。
-> Data isbased onof each flow.
-> What is a flow?
flow,即为流量 。其定义并不是固定的 。flow可以是两个host之间所有的流量,也可是仅仅是两个应用比如skype之间的流量
Introduction to Computer Networks(网络架构与七

文章插图
-> FIFO, Round-Robin,(-of- (QoS))
这些机制被交换机所运用 。
FIFO:先进先出 。每个host都有封包进来,先进的封包先出去,用的是link的所有频宽 。当大家负载都差不多大的时候,大家所使用的资源是平均的 。当有些用户负载较小时,当其送完,那么频宽就可以都给负载大的用户使用了,是相对公平的做法 。
Round-Robin:每个用户的封包进入交换机后,都有一个queue 。每个queue轮流送封包出去 。公平 。
:还可以为queue设立优先级,优先级高的先送 。例如,视讯会议此类需要先送封包,保证了QoS的服务 。而FDM,TDM此类是不会管这个的 。
->?(拥塞?)
肯定会掉封包,但是掉哪个,会有具体的策略,以后再说 。
4.
两个host之间建立连线,属于,因为不会有实实在在的物理连线,而且封包传送时一般走的也是不同的path 。
Introduction to Computer Networks(网络架构与七

文章插图
5.
hide the .
1) Bits are lost
-> Bit(1 to a 0, and vice versa)
-> Burst–
我们的资料在传送时,是一个bit一个bit传送的,而我们传送bit的link一般为同轴电缆,光纤或者无线 。同轴电缆用电压高低表示0和1,容易受电场干扰,发生错误;光纤用光的亮度强弱表示0和1;而无线用电磁波强弱表示0和1,容易受电磁波干扰,发生错误 。